Taquito Local Forging package

TypeDoc style documentation is available here

General Information

Forging is the act of encoding your operation shell into its binary representation. Forging can be done either remotely by the RPC node, or locally. @taquito/local-forging is an npm package that provides developers with local forging functionality.

Operations must be forged and signed before it gets injected to the blockchain.

Example of an unforged operation:

{
  branch: 'BLzyjjHKEKMULtvkpSHxuZxx6ei6fpntH2BTkYZiLgs8zLVstvX',
    contents: [
        {
          kind: 'origination',
          counter: '1',
          source: 'tz1QZ6KY7d3BuZDT1d19dUxoQrtFPN2QJ3hn',
          fee: '10000',
          gas_limit: '10',
          storage_limit: '10',
          balance: '0',
          script: [Object]
        }
    ]
}

A forged operation:

a99b946c97ada0f42c1bdeae0383db7893351232a832d00d0cd716eb6f66e5616d0035e993d8c7aaa42b5e3ccd86a33390ececc73abd904e010a0a000000000011020000000c0500036c0501036c0502038d00000002030b

The forged values can then be parsed back into its JSON counterpart

Install

Install the package as follows

npm install @taquito/local-forging

Usage

import { TezosToolkit } from '@taquito/taquito'
import { LocalForger } from '@taquito/local-forging'

const Tezos = new TezosToolkit('https://YOUR_PREFERRED_RPC_URL');
Tezos.setProvider({ forger: localForger })
